How they compare

Gabon currently reports 111.22 base year varies by country against 109.75 base year varies by country in Ecuador, a difference of 1.47 base year varies by country.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 56 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Ecuador ahead.

Ecuador ranks 155th and Gabon ranks 152nd of 169 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Ecuador averaged higher in 2 and Gabon in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Ecuador Gabon Difference Ahead
1970s 20.74 base year varies by country 15.26 base year varies by country 5.48 base year varies by country Ecuador
1980s 34.51 base year varies by country 40.08 base year varies by country 5.58 base year varies by country Gabon
1990s 37.04 base year varies by country 72.85 base year varies by country 35.81 base year varies by country Gabon
2000s 60.97 base year varies by country 107.91 base year varies by country 46.94 base year varies by country Gabon
2010s 96.6 base year varies by country 118.36 base year varies by country 21.75 base year varies by country Gabon
2020s 104.75 base year varies by country 101.82 base year varies by country 2.93 base year varies by country Ecuador

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Gross national expenditure is the sum of household final consumption expenditure, general government final consumption expenditure, and gross capital formation. A deflator is the ratio of an indicator in current prices over the same series in constant prices. The base year varies by country.
